Transaction 3affe5ece199e4680583d2b3bc733767968f6d448927c25d05a02c1f754486e4

1 Input
2 Outputs
  • 3affe5ece199e4680583d2b3bc733767968f6d448927c25d05a02c1f754486e4:0
  • value  24573060
    address  1E8eyW9wGmMgWLQQAYeij5T6ScY8dJ8bUt
  • 3affe5ece199e4680583d2b3bc733767968f6d448927c25d05a02c1f754486e4:1
  • value  1705396992
    address  1hWcpM3uhm6WsrnC89Wsx7vcJKhiSmbqR